you have an overpair and it's a major mistake to check the flop. you have to bet. you have always been scared to run into some monsterhand but you have to realize that your opponents does just hit the flop in 33% of the times with a hand like KQ and they are very often unimproved and it might happen sometimes that somebody flopped the straight or a set but thats relatively unlikely to the scenario that they have either nothing or a weak madehand that you beat. bet/3bet on the flop and when somebody goes crazy and beyond reasonable action.
